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ations For Airsoft Tracer Units

  • Thread compatibility and adapters: Most models use a 14mm CCW thread with M14- to M11+ adapters. Confirm compatibility with your M4’s muzzle and any suppressor or barrel extensions you may use.
  • BB compatibility: Choose units that support your preferred BB type—green tracer BBs, gel BBs, or standard BBs. Some units offer multi-color options for enhanced visibility.
  • Lighting modes and color options: Decide between single-color tracers, color-changing RGB options, or flare-style effects. Consider how modes affect battery life and field readability.
  • Power and charging: Check whether batteries are included or if you’ll need separate charging solutions. Consider expected run time under your typical game length.
  • Durability and mounting: Look for anti-drop designs or rugged housings. A reliable quick-attach interface helps with field maintenance and replacement.
  • Software/app features: Some models offer Bluetooth or app-based control for lighting modes and chronograph integration. Assess whether this level of control matches your play style.
  • Visibility in various lighting: Green tracers work well in dim outdoor settings, while red tracers can offer distinct visibility in shadowed areas. RGB options provide customization but may consume more power.
  • Legal and safety considerations: Tracer units are designed for airsoft use only and should be used in compliance with local field rules and safety guidelines.
  • Maintenance needs: Regular cleaning of lenses, checking wiring, and ensuring LED longevity helps maximize performance over time.
  • Value assessment: Compare brightness, mode variety, build quality, and ease of installation to determine best overall value for your M4 platform.

In practice, players often balance brightness with battery life and ease of use. Rugged designs with simple mode switches tend to deliver reliable performance in fast-paced games. RGB models add customization for team coordination, while simpler green/gel options offer straightforward, dependable tracking. Evaluating your typical game environment—indoor arenas, outdoor dusk, or night skirmishes—will guide the best unit choice for your M4 build.
